The Nike P-6000 trainers are designed for infants who need a reliable, comfortable shoe that blends heritage-inspired style with modern functionality. These trainers feature a breathable mesh upper and cushioned insole, making them ideal for everyday play, though the beige and pink aesthetic requires frequent cleaning to maintain its original look. By combining elements from the Nike Pegasus 25 and 2006 models, these shoes offer a lightweight yet durable option for developing feet.

FAQs

Are these shoes machine washable?

No, it is recommended to spot clean these shoes by hand to preserve the structure and reflective materials.

What age group are these trainers designed for?

The P-6000 trainers in this series are specifically sized for infants and young children.

Do these shoes provide good arch support?

The cushioned insole provides general comfort and support suitable for developing infant feet during casual wear.

Are the reflective details visible in daylight?

The reflective elements are most effective in low-light or dark conditions when a light source hits them directly.

Can these be worn for running?

While durable, these are lifestyle trainers designed for casual use rather than intensive sports or distance running.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To achieve the best fit, ensure the laces are threaded properly to secure the heel without putting excessive pressure on the arch. These trainers are standard infant sizes and pair well with everyday casual attire. To maintain the appearance of the mesh and overlays, perform regular surface cleaning. Use a soft-bristled brush or a damp cloth with mild soap to remove debris. Avoid submerging the shoes in water or putting them in the washing machine, as this can degrade the adhesive and cushioning materials. Allow the shoes to air dry naturally away from direct heat sources like radiators to prevent material warping.
